What is another word for withershins?

Pronunciation: [wˈɪðəʃˌɪnz] (IPA)

Withershins refers to moving in a counterclockwise direction. Some synonyms for withershins include anticlockwise, counterclockwise, widdershins, and contrarywise. While these words describe the same direction, there are subtle differences in their usage and connotation. Similarly, some words that have a similar meaning to withershins include backwards, reverse, or retrograde motion. What are the opposite words for withershins?

Withershins is a old-fashioned word that refers to moving in a counterclockwise direction or going against the natural course of things. The antonyms for withershins include clockwise, sunwise, deasil, or dexter. These words describe moving in the same direction as the hands of a clock or following the natural order of things. Clockwise is the most common opposite of withershins and is used to describe something moving in the direction of the hands of a clock. Sunwise is another word that denotes movement in the direction of the sun, typically in a clockwise direction. Deasil and dexter are other words that can be used as antonyms for withershins.
